When talking with <u>Lee Tiffany</u> of S & R he said how well  <br>
<u>NUMBLES</u> and <u>SCRABBLE FOR JUNIORS</u> was doing in schools. Also  <br>
about setting up <u>SCRABBLE</u> tournaments all over the country.  <br>
Thinking of a <u>GAME</u> idea. Cards are provided as shown with  <br>
different layouts on the two sides.
[Diagram of a rectangle divided into 8 sections. 6 rectangles which are yellow (3), red (2), and blue (1) in color. Bounded at top and bottom by thin white rectanges.]
A board with grooves in a grid is included. Players place  <br>
the cards into the grooves so that in each  <br>
reentrant right angle the colors match. Or possibly  <br>
not all have to match. Count for matches, and a  <br>
larger number for mismatches.
